Details
-
Type: Bug
-
Status: Closed
-
Priority: Major
-
Resolution: Fixed
-
Affects Version/s: EE-3.3.0.GA_P01, 4.0.BETA
-
Fix Version/s: 4.0, EE-3.3.0.GA_P03
-
Component/s: ACE-Components
-
Labels:None
-
Environment:ICEfaces3/trunk revision# 37781, EE-3.3.0.GA Maintenance Branch, Icefaces 4 trunk.
-
Assignee Priority:P3
Description
Test application is located at: iceads1/Public/QA/JIRAs/ICE-9569.war
There are issues when swapping the backing data of the table when sorting and/or filtering are applied.
Filtering Issue:
The data set that is shown after swapping the data is always one step behind. Once filtered, swapping the data the first time doesn't appear to do anything visually but the data has actually swaped in the back end. Swapping the data again makes it appear the data has swapped correctly but it is actually still one swap behind. If you remove the filter it will show the correct data.
To reproduce:
1) Deploy test app
2) Type a character into one of the filter fields
3) Click 'Swap Data'. This first click will appear to do nothing but the data has actually swapped in the bean.
4) Click 'Swap Data' again. This time the data appears to swap but it is actually the data set that was supposed to be shown in the previous swap.
5) Remove the filter. The correct data is shown (the opposite to what is shown when filtering is applied).
Sorting:
There are no issues with the data actually swapping when sorting but the sorting does not get applied to the newly swapped data.
To reproduce:
1) Deploy test app
2) Sort one of the columns into a new order
3) Click 'Swap Data'. The sorting that was previously applied will not carry over to the new data set.
There are issues when swapping the backing data of the table when sorting and/or filtering are applied.
Filtering Issue:
The data set that is shown after swapping the data is always one step behind. Once filtered, swapping the data the first time doesn't appear to do anything visually but the data has actually swaped in the back end. Swapping the data again makes it appear the data has swapped correctly but it is actually still one swap behind. If you remove the filter it will show the correct data.
To reproduce:
1) Deploy test app
2) Type a character into one of the filter fields
3) Click 'Swap Data'. This first click will appear to do nothing but the data has actually swapped in the bean.
4) Click 'Swap Data' again. This time the data appears to swap but it is actually the data set that was supposed to be shown in the previous swap.
5) Remove the filter. The correct data is shown (the opposite to what is shown when filtering is applied).
Sorting:
There are no issues with the data actually swapping when sorting but the sorting does not get applied to the newly swapped data.
To reproduce:
1) Deploy test app
2) Sort one of the columns into a new order
3) Click 'Swap Data'. The sorting that was previously applied will not carry over to the new data set.
Activity
Cruz Miraback
created issue -
Cruz Miraback
made changes -
Field | Original Value | New Value |
---|---|---|
Description |
There are issues when swapping the backing data of the table when sorting and/or filtering are applied.
Filtering Issue: The data set that is shown after swapping the data is always one step behind. Once filtered, swapping the data the first time doesn't appear to do anything visually but the data has actually swaped in the back end. Swapping the data again makes it appear the data has swapped correctly but it is actually still one swap behind. If you remove the filter it will show the correct data. To reproduce: 1) Deploy test app 2) Type a character into one of the filter fields 3) Click 'Swap Data'. This first click will appear to do nothing but the data has actually swapped in the bean. 4) Click 'Swap Data' again. This time the data appears to swap but it is actually the data set that was supposed to be shown in the previous swap. 5) Remove the filter. The correct data is shown (the opposite to what is shown when filtering is applied). Sorting: There are no issues with the data actually swapping when sorting but the sorting does not get applied to the newly swapped data. To reproduce: 1) Deploy test app 2) Sort one of the columns into a new order 3) Click 'Swap Data'. The sorting that was previously applied will not carry over to the new data set. |
Test application is located at: iceads1/Public/QA/JIRAs/ There are issues when swapping the backing data of the table when sorting and/or filtering are applied. Filtering Issue: The data set that is shown after swapping the data is always one step behind. Once filtered, swapping the data the first time doesn't appear to do anything visually but the data has actually swaped in the back end. Swapping the data again makes it appear the data has swapped correctly but it is actually still one swap behind. If you remove the filter it will show the correct data. To reproduce: 1) Deploy test app 2) Type a character into one of the filter fields 3) Click 'Swap Data'. This first click will appear to do nothing but the data has actually swapped in the bean. 4) Click 'Swap Data' again. This time the data appears to swap but it is actually the data set that was supposed to be shown in the previous swap. 5) Remove the filter. The correct data is shown (the opposite to what is shown when filtering is applied). Sorting: There are no issues with the data actually swapping when sorting but the sorting does not get applied to the newly swapped data. To reproduce: 1) Deploy test app 2) Sort one of the columns into a new order 3) Click 'Swap Data'. The sorting that was previously applied will not carry over to the new data set. |
Ken Fyten
made changes -
Assignee | Nils Lundquist [ nils.lundquist ] |
Ken Fyten
made changes -
Assignee | Nils Lundquist [ nils.lundquist ] | Arturo Zambrano [ artzambrano ] |
Assignee Priority | P2 [ 10011 ] |
Ken Fyten
made changes -
Fix Version/s | 4.0 [ 11382 ] | |
Fix Version/s | 4.0.BETA [ 10770 ] |
Liana Munroe
made changes -
Environment | ICEfaces3/trunk revision# 37781 | ICEfaces3/trunk revision# 37781, EE-3.3.0.GA Maintenance Branch, Icefaces 4 trunk. |
Liana Munroe
made changes -
Affects Version/s | EE-3.3.0.GA_P01 [ 11174 ] |
Arturo Zambrano
made changes -
Status | Open [ 1 ] | Resolved [ 5 ] |
Resolution | Fixed [ 1 ] |
Ken Fyten
made changes -
Status | Resolved [ 5 ] | Closed [ 6 ] |
Judy Guglielmin
made changes -
Resolution | Fixed [ 1 ] | |
Status | Closed [ 6 ] | Reopened [ 4 ] |
Assignee Priority | P2 [ 10011 ] | P3 [ 10012 ] |
Security | Private [ 10001 ] |
Judy Guglielmin
made changes -
Fix Version/s | EE-3.3.0.GA_P03 [ 11572 ] |
Judy Guglielmin
made changes -
Status | Reopened [ 4 ] | Closed [ 6 ] |
Resolution | Fixed [ 1 ] |
Ken Fyten
made changes -
Resolution | Fixed [ 1 ] | |
Status | Closed [ 6 ] | Reopened [ 4 ] |
Security | Private [ 10001 ] |
Ken Fyten
made changes -
Status | Reopened [ 4 ] | Resolved [ 5 ] |
Resolution | Fixed [ 1 ] |
Ken Fyten
made changes -
Status | Resolved [ 5 ] | Closed [ 6 ] |
Issue reproduced also with IF4 trunk rev# 39869.